Respondents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, praying for issuance of a Writ of Certiorarified Mandamus, to call for the records pertaining to the impugned order bearing No.21428/Tha.Ku3/2024 dated

26.11.2024 passed by the third respondent and quash the same and consecutively direct the respondents to grant emergency leave for 15 days without escort to the detenu, Pasupathi, S/o Palaniyappan, aged about 65 years, Convict No.24098, detained at Central Prison, Coimbatore. For Petitioner ::

ORDER

(Order of the Court was made by S.M.SUBRAMANIAM,J.) W.M.P.No.137 of 2025 seeking to dispense with the production of original copy of impugned order stands ordered.

2. The rejection of leave application is under challenge. The learned counsel for petitioner submits that the application seeking emergency leave was submitted, which was not considered, which resulted in the filing of the present writ proceedings.

3. The Probation Officer in his report recommended the case of the prisoner for grant of emergency leave. The reason stated in the application

is also found to be correct. Thus we are inclined to pass the following order:- (i) The impugned order passed by the third respondent dated 26.11.2024 is set aside.

(ii)The prisoner, namely, Pasupathi, S/o Palaniyappan, Convict No.24098 (PID No.222411), is granted six days emergency leave without escort.

(iii)The leave shall commence from 31.01.2025 10.30 A.M., and the prisoner shall surrender before the third respondent by 5.30 P.M., on 05.02.2025.

(iv)The prisoner shall appear before the Velayuthampalayam Police Station, Karur District on 02.02.2025 and 04.02.2025 at 11.00 A.M. during the period of leave.

The writ petition stands allowed on the above terms. No costs. Index : yes (S.M.S.,J.) (M.J.R.,J.) 27.01.2025 ss To
